Q1:

The type of liquor circulation system to be ' employed in evaporators (viz. natural or forced circulation) is determined mainly by the __________ of the liquid.

A viscosity

B density

C thermal conductivity

D corrosive nature

ANS:A - viscosity

The type of liquor circulation system to be employed in evaporators (natural or forced circulation) is determined mainly by the viscosity of the liquid. Viscosity is a measure of a fluid's resistance to flow. In evaporators, the circulation system needs to effectively transport the liquid through the evaporator tubes to ensure efficient heat transfer and evaporation. The viscosity of the liquid significantly influences its flow behavior:

  1. Natural Circulation: Natural circulation relies on buoyancy forces generated by density differences within the fluid. Liquids with lower viscosity typically have better flow characteristics, facilitating natural circulation. Therefore, natural circulation is often preferred for liquids with lower viscosity, as it can efficiently circulate the liquid without the need for external pumps.
  2. Forced Circulation: Forced circulation involves the use of external pumps to actively circulate the liquid through the evaporator. Liquids with higher viscosity may have difficulty flowing through the evaporator tubes, requiring the assistance of pumps to overcome resistance and ensure adequate circulation. Therefore, forced circulation is typically employed for liquids with higher viscosity to ensure consistent flow rates and efficient heat transfer.
While other factors such as density, thermal conductivity, and corrosive nature may also influence the choice of circulation system to some extent, viscosity is the primary factor that dictates the suitability of natural or forced circulation in evaporators.
